Abstract/Summary:
Catawba, Concord, Golden Muscat, Delaware, Campbell are introduced grape varities for juicing from USA. Taking these juicing grapes for materials, the main photosynthetic characteristics were studied; biological characteristics, such as phonological phases, botanical traits and agricultural economics properties were observed in Yangling from 2009 to 2010. Meanwhile, using natural identification in the field, the general resistance of these juicing grapes to powdery mildew, anthracnose and downy mildew was researched in order to investigate their agronomic characters and provide juice-making industry with theoretical foundation. The results are as below:1. All of the introduced juicing grapes bud on late-Mar., Delaware and Campbell were mid-varieties, Catawba, Concord and Golden Muscat were late-varieties.2. All of the introduced juicing grapes were able to growth normally and showed botanical traits of Vivis. labrusca L. Mature leaf size of introduced juicing grapes was between 149.3 and 355.3cm2; internode length of woody shoot was between 5.5 and 15.5cm, internode diameter of woody shoot was between 0.4 and 0.9cm; bunch size was between 18.6 and 164.2cm2, bunch weight was between 15.5 and 213.8g; berry size was between 1.32 and 4.56cm2, berry weight was between 0.8 and 4.4g; percentage of must was between 61.8 and 70.2%.3. Growth vigor of Catawba, Concord and Golden Muscat were stronger than Delaware and Campbell. Percentage of bud burst of introduced juicing grapes was between 64.6 and 86.2%; percentage of bearing shoots was between 54.5 and 91.4%; cluster number per bearing shoot was between 1.4 and 2.1; mean production per tree was between 63.4 and 5350.0g. Golden Muscat had the highest yield, its mean production per tree reached 5350.0g.4. All of the introduced juicing grapes showed strong disease resistance. Concord, Delaware, Campbell were high resistant to powdery mildew, Golden Muscat and Catawba were resistant to powdery mildew; all of the introduced juicing grapes were resistant to anthracnose; Delaware was high resistant to downy mildew, others were resistant to downy mildew.5. Light compensation point of introduced juicing grapes was between 23.9 and 42.2μmol·m-2·s-1; light saturation point was between 1575.0 and 1642.9μmol·m-2·s-1; CO2 compensation point was between 65.1 and 74.3μmol·mol-1; CO2 saturation point was between 897.5 and 1061.7μmol·mol-1; apparent quantum yield was between 0.036 and 0.044mol·mol-1; carboxylation efficiency was between 0.067 and 0.095mol·m-2·s-1. In the aspect of net photosynthetic rate, apparent quantum yield, carboxylation efficiency, maximum regeneration rate of RuBP, Golden Muscat was higher than Catawba and Concord. In accord with the higher yield, Golden Muscat showed higher photosynthetic capacity.
